  1. The Dancer and the Thief (Spanish: El baile de la victoria) is a 2009 drama film directed by Fernando Trueba. It is an adaptation of the novel of the same name by author Antonio Skármeta. It was selected as the Spanish entry for the Best Foreign Language Film at the 82nd Academy Awards, but it was not nominated.
